Help for young carers

Teen Health 11-19 advice for young carers

The Teen Health 11-19 service will follow the Department of Health Supporting the health and wellbeing of young carers guidance and care pathway where appropriate. 

Teen Health and Student Support staff can: 

  • tell you about where you can get help outside school 
  • answer questions you may have about the illness or condition of the person you look after 
  • check that you’re okay and coping with the situation 
  • refer you for a carer’s assessment 

You can make your first appointment with the health and wellbeing officer or student support staff through: 

  • the teacher or staff member you chose to speak to 
  • going along to a drop-in clinic at your school 
  • your doctor (GP) 
  • a referral form which you can get from your head of year 
  • your parent or guardian who can make an appointment for you through the school
